To go to the screening, I made my son a Mike Wazowski shirt. This shirt is seriously easy to make (it took me less than 30 minutes), and I know he’ll enjoy wearing it all summer long. Plus it is a fun souvenir from our fun night out.

Supplies:
Green t-shirt (try to find one in “Mike Wazowski” green)
Freezer paper
Pencil
Fabric paint in white, black, green, and 2 shades of blue
Paintbrush

I prepped my t-shirt by ironing freezer paper to the inside of the shirt. This will keep the paint from seeping through and making the shirt stick together. I printed out a picture of Mike Wazowski, and lightly drew an outline on the shirt. This is easier than it sounds – a large circle for the eye, with a smaller circle for the iris and an even smaller one for the pupil. A crescent at the top and bottom of the eye for the eyelids. For the mouth, semi-circle with more semi circles for the teeth, and then an arc for the mouth. It is just shapes!

I started with the white, painting the white of the eye, and the teeth.

I roughly mixed two shades of blue together and painted the iris with broad strokes to give it more dimension.

I then painted in the black of the mouth and the pupil. The last step was the lip and eyelids in green. I picked a Mike Wazowski green that was a different shade than the shirt, and painted them on.

I added a black line in the top eyelid for the crease, and a white spot on the iris (at my son’s request – because that is what it shows in the photo) and I was all done! It just needed to try for 24 hours before I put my kiddo in the bright, bright sun to take a picture of him in his shirt.
